Overview
This course provides an excellent introduction to the principles and practices involved in Personal Accident and Sickness insurance. It explores the aspects, which need to be understood by those involved in providing basic technical or administrative services.
The course is delivered for groups of delegates on behalf of employers at client premises or external venues arranged for organisations anywhere in the UK.
Please note that it is not offered as an open course for individual delegate bookings.
Description
Workshop content
What is Personal Accident & Sickness Insurance?
What is the market and why do people purchase PA and sickness insurance?
- background and type of policy – e.g. single, group, PA & sickness etc.
Accident cover and Sickness cover
- a review of policy cover including the scope of typical cover and principles of non-indemnity insurance, including:
- features and benefits and policy extensions including levels of cover
- policy definitions
- conditions
- exclusions
A useful guide to practical claims investigation, including;
- checking the claim form and claim documentation and checking policy cover including exclusions
- liaison with GPs and specialists and the importance of the accessing Medical Reports Act 1998
- fraud indicators and the use of external investigators
- calculating benefits and settlements
This section will include relevant case law and case studies.
Who is this course for?
The course can be used as a good grounding for trainees or those who have potential to develop in their careers into more technically demanding work in the future. The principles covered are those, which apply as a basis for all Personal Accident and Sickness insurance.
